jscript play button works in iphone but not ipad
I have a simple play js button on my HTML page as well as embedded music. So when you are a computer the music autoplays then stops and you have the option to listen to it again with the js button. This "theoretically" will work fine for the iPhone and iPad because even though the embedded music isn't auto playing the user can still click the listen button and hear the music. It works on the iPhone perfectly but not the iPad. I'm at a loss.
Here is my jscript:
function FFFFSound(soundobj) {
var thissound= eval("document."+soundobj);
thissound.Play();
}
here is my embedded links in the HTML:
<embed src="music/FFFFKids.mp3" autostart="true" loop="false" hidden="true">
<embed src="music/FFFFKids.mp3" autostart="false" loop="false" hidden="true" name="sound1">
and here is my button:
<input type="button" value="Listen" onClick="FFFFSound('sound1')" class="listen_button">
You can see it at www.feefifofun.com
Any thoughts??
